wdk

    1热度

    1回答

    与 Preinstalling Driver on Windows 8.1 Fails中描述的情况相同。 但是有没有修复如何重新安装相同的驱动程序包(无guid更改),而无需重新安装8.1? 现状: 在全新的Windows 8.1的安装(没有升级8.0),我们的USB设备无法安装。行为可以通过虚拟机来重现: 创建注册表项,从INF文件GUID来显示正确的USB图标,并在设备管理器中创建自己的组类:

    1热度

    1回答

    在较早的Visual Studios(例如2008)中,有一个“工具构建顺序”菜单。从该菜单中,我可以选择不使用C/C++编译器,而是在自定义构建工具中使用我自己的。 我想在Visual Studio 2013中做同样的事情,但该菜单似乎已经消失。我如何获得相同的效果?我的目标是拥有使用Visual Studio 2013编译器构建的1个目标(例如Debug),以便我可以获得所有漂亮的代码分析输出

    0热度

    1回答

    我有麻烦入门建立一个打印监控/打印处理器为使用Windows的Visual Studio 2012旗舰版与WDK 8.基本上,这就是我要完成的: 创建打印监视器(一些应用程序可以打印到),将产生与应打印的内容(如默认XPS打印机或PDF打印机)的文件,然后调用打印处理程序 创建打印处理程序,它将解析生成的文件并对其执行某些操作(检查是否存在某些文本,在线上载文件等) 我觉得像打印处理部分不应该太硬

    -1热度

    3回答

    我想创建一个隐藏设备的功能,例如在资源管理器(例如,使E驱动器不可见)下的DISK ON KEY。 我应该强调我只想隐藏我的电脑下的设备(或驱动器盘符),而不是完全卸载它。只是让用户看不到它。 如何以编程方式执行此操作,而不强制重新启动或终止浏览器以使更改生效?

    1热度

    1回答

    当前的8.x Windows驱动程序工具包样本包含多士炉样本,但仅在KMDF和UMDF中实施。我有一个特殊的应用程序,需要专门处理PNP消息,我认为这不会与KMDF一起使用。有没有人知道在哪里可以得到WDM版本的烤面包机,这些烤面包机曾经是样品?

    0热度

    1回答

    我中定义的宏来DbgPrint到打印消息时_DEBUG定义 #define MYDBGPRINT(X) #ifdef _DEBUG \ DbgPrint(X) \ #endif 但输出是从DbgPrint不同例如 ULONG id=0; MYDBGPRINT("the value of the id : %u ",id) //outputs garbage DbgPrint("

    1热度

    1回答

    我有一个文件筛选器驱动程序,应该在特定情况下禁止文件/目录访问。 我使用IoRegisterFsRegistrationChange来获取有关文件系统更改的通知,并附加到适当的卷设备对象。 它通常是一个传递过滤器。它处理的唯一事情是IRP_MJ_CREATE(实际上禁止某些类型的文件/目录访问)。所有其他IRP和快速I/O请求都只传递给底层设备。 它工作正常,除了一件事。如果驱动程序在系统启动时加

    2热度

    1回答

    有没有办法通过使用Windows c/C++ API(例如PnP Configuration Manager API)获取设备的PCI坐标(总线/插槽/功能编号)?我已经知道如何在内核模式下执行它,我需要一个用户模式解决方案。我的目标系统是Windows XP-32位。

    0热度

    1回答

    ObRegisterCallbacks‘s自Vista SP1以来可用,允许“注册线程和进程句柄操作的回调例程列表”。 例如,您正在注册PsSetCreateProcessNotifyRoutine回调。您可以使用PC Hunter之类的软件取消它的设置,因为x86窗口没有内核级别的修补程序。而司机不知道它不再需要这个回调。 的问题: 如何驾驶者可以检查它的回调与ObRegisterCallbac

    2热度

    1回答

    我试图修改MSDN link中提供的UVC扩展单元代码。我已经向XUProxy.cpp中提供的CExtension类添加了其他方法。所有这些方法都添加到interface.idl文件中。 这是代码片段。如在http://msdn.microsoft.com/en-us/library/windows/desktop/dd377566%28v=vs.85%29.aspx提供 STDMETHODIMP